Abstract

A moisture absorption type filter for a fuel tank relating to a filter is composed of a housing (1), a top solid particle filter (2), a high-performance hygroscopic agent (3), activated carbons (4) and a bottom solid particle filter (5); the top solid particle filter (2) is arranged inside the housing (1); the high-performance hygroscopic agent (3) is disposed under the top solid particle filter (2); the bottom solid particle filter (5) is disposed under the high-performance hygroscopic agent (3); and activated carbons (4) are disposed under the bottom solid particle filter (5). The moisture absorption type filter could filter air inputting in and outputting out of the fuel tank and ensure input air to be dry without moisture so as not to pollute the lubricating oil; output air is free of gaseous lubricating oil and other harmful impurities so as to prevent atmosphere air from being polluted and greatly prolong service life of the lubricating oil.

Background technology:
In heavy industry enterprise, the lubricating oil of various large-scale reductors is very important.The quality of lubricating oil directly influences the service life and the failure-frequency of reductor and main equipment.Lubricating oil in large-scale deceleration machine oil station fuel tank often is worth and surpasses 100,000 yuan, and the main cause that oil degenerates is that moisture and dust exceed standard in the oil.The main channel that moisture and dust enter lubricating oil is exactly at fuel tank air-vent place.And be used for the fuel tank moisture absorption type filter at fuel tank filtering holes place at present, and filter the air of turnover fuel tank, can not guarantee air inlet dry no moisture, not pollution lubricating oil fully; Giving vent to anger still contains gaseous state lubricating oil and other objectionable impurities sometimes, and air is had pollution.

In order to solve the existing problem of background technology, the utility model is by the following technical solutions: it is made up of shell, last solid particle filter, high-performance hygroscopic agent, active carbon and following solid particle filter, enclosure is provided with solid particle filter, last solid particle filter below is provided with the high-performance hygroscopic agent, high-performance hygroscopic agent below is provided with down solid particle filter, and following solid particle filter below is provided with active carbon.
The utility model is that the lifting by fuel tank liquid level can cause that all air enters the moisture absorption type filter, air filters dust through one two microns last solid particle filter, then air diffusion, pass the high-performance hygroscopic agent, it is made by silica gel, very effective, can absorb in the air 90% moisture, again through solid particle filter down, at last through falling pernicious gas through activated carbon filtration, by above filtration, clean, dry gas enters oil drum, fuel tank and gear-box are when gas returns, active carbon can absorb organic gas, when the silica gel moisture absorption reached capacity, it will become aubergine, and that just need have been changed.
